I had a DivX film then converted it to mpeg now am using VCDeasy to burn it.
When i add my mpeg film to the list to be burned i get the following error message.
VCD requires MPEG1files not MPEG2 files, do you want to add the file anyway?
Why does it say this and will it work if i continue?

it says that cause your trying to use an MPEG2 file.. What program did you use to convert the DivX to MPEG? what settings did you use?Originally Posted by manchesterman
If you make a SVCD you can use an MPEG2 file. -
If you're file is an MPEG-2 select SVCD 1.0, but if it's an MPEG-1 file, select VCD 2.0.
